US Considers Ban on Chinese Datacenter Components Amid AI Development Concerns (Aug 04, 2026)

The Trump administration is reportedly developing a ban on US imports of new models of Chinese datacenter components, a measure indicating heightened efforts by US authorities to address the rapid development of artificial intelligence (AI) technology in China [2]. This proposed restriction, if implemented, would impact key infrastructure for data processing and AI capabilities.

What Happened

  • The Federal Communications Commission (FCC) is reportedly drafting a measure to bar imports of new Chinese optical transceivers [2].
  • Optical transceivers are critical components that enable data to travel over telecommunications networks [2].
  • Four individuals familiar with the matter indicated that the Trump administration's FCC is behind this initiative [2].
  • This action is described as the latest effort by US authorities to respond to China's rapid development in AI technology [2].
  • The ban would specifically target new models of Chinese datacenter devices [2].

Why It Matters

This reported ban on Chinese datacenter components, specifically optical transceivers, carries significant implications for the global technology sector and the ongoing strategic competition between the United States and China [2]. Optical transceivers are fundamental to modern datacenter operations, serving as the conduits through which vast amounts of data are transmitted at high speeds. Their role is particularly critical in the infrastructure supporting artificial intelligence, where rapid and efficient data flow is essential for training complex models and deploying AI applications. By restricting access to these components, the US aims to directly impact China's capacity to build out and enhance its advanced computing infrastructure, thereby potentially slowing its progress in AI development [2].

The proposed measure by the FCC reflects a deepening concern within the Trump administration regarding the national security implications of China's rapid advancements in AI technology [2]. This initiative can be viewed as a targeted effort to disrupt key supply chains that enable China's technological growth, particularly in areas deemed critical for future economic and military advantage. Such actions underscore a broader US strategy to limit the transfer of sensitive technologies to China, aiming to maintain a technological lead and mitigate perceived risks associated with China's dual-use technological capabilities. The focus on new models of components suggests an attempt to prevent future enhancements rather than solely addressing existing infrastructure [2].

For US companies, a ban would necessitate a re-evaluation of their supply chains for datacenter components. While the immediate impact would be on imports of new Chinese models, it could prompt a broader shift towards non-Chinese suppliers, potentially leading to increased procurement costs, longer lead times, and a re-configuration of manufacturing and sourcing strategies. This aligns with the observation that US authorities are “scrambling to respond” to China's AI development, indicating a reactive and urgent policy posture [2]. The measure could also influence investment decisions in both countries, as companies assess the stability and reliability of global technology supply chains under increasing geopolitical pressure.
